LIGHTS

IMPORTANT:
Your microwave oven features LED interior lighting as well as
LED surface lighting. These lights are designed to last for the life of your
microwave oven. However, if the lights stop illuminating, please contact a
qualified technician for replacement or the Customer Satisfaction Center for
service. See the back cover for contact information.
